
Softball Takes Series In 7-4 Win Over Michigan State
Apr 12 | Softball
PISCATAWAY, N.J. – Rutgers softball got the series win on the Michigan State Spartans on Sunday afternoon at the RU Softball Complex as the Scarlet Knights never trailed in its 7-4 victory.
Bailey Burtis kicked off the day with an RBI double and Addie Osborne collected her ninth home run of the year in the win.
The win moved RU to 20-21 overall and 5-13 in the Big Ten.

| THE RUNDOWN |
- Rutgers' first at-bat resulted in two runs on three hits and a lead the Scarlet Knights would never lose. Sam Rohwer led off with a single and put up the afternoon's first run on Baileigh Burtis' double to center.
- Two batters later, Burtis made it 2-0 coming home a fielder's choice from Sam Delhoyo.
- The Scarlet Knights achieved a 5-0 lead after two innings in the book. What appeared to be a routine fly out in the outfield to retire the side with the bases loaded, Burtis' fly ball to left popped out of the Spartan's glove and allowed a trio of runs to score.
- Michigan State got on the board in the third. The Spartans loaded the bases for Natalia Kenyatta to score on a ground out to second from Britain Beshears.
- The Spartans added another run in the fourth. A sac bunt moved Kirsten Caravaca over to third where she was able to plate on a ground out to short from Payton Conroy.
- RU got the two runs back in the fifth with an Addie Osborne home run to right and RBI coming from Sam Rohwer up the middle scoring Eva Garofalo.
- A Michigan State home run narrowed the gap in the seventh on a two-run home run to left from Sophia Grillo.
